Output 23afbed66ea3a416c1e667edf5e60f7f403ba00e5e223d230c5fdbabef03df5a:9

value
10877548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b0e86820b13eb46599888de77f80431f1c5a0a OP_EQUAL
address
38bEXhjiJtquE7pAcrvUFrPTQ6Dyu212TD
transaction
23afbed66ea3a416c1e667edf5e60f7f403ba00e5e223d230c5fdbabef03df5a
spent
true